Latest Patents
Giles' latest patents include a catalyst system that enhances the production of acetic acid through the carbonylation of methanol. This process involves contacting methanol or its reactive derivatives with carbon monoxide in a liquid reaction composition that includes acetic acid, an iridium catalyst, methyl iodide, water, and methyl acetate. The use of ruthenium and osmium as promoters significantly improves the efficiency of this process. Another notable patent focuses on the carbonylation of alkyl alcohols, where the presence of an iridium catalyst, alkyl halide, and water is promoted by various elements, including cadmium, mercury, and zinc, among others.
